Add to basketA Tagore Reader, edited by Amiya Chakravarty, is a curated collection of the works of Rabindranath Tagore, the renowned Bengali poet, philosopher, and Nobel laureate. The anthology showcases a selection of Tagore's poetry, short stories, essays, and songs, offering readers a comprehensive view of his literary and philosophical contributions. Tagore's works in this collection reflect themes of love, spirituality, nature, and the search for human meaning. His unique blending of Eastern and Western thought, along with his deep concern for social and cultural issues, is evident throughout the pieces. This reader serves as an introduction to Tagore s vast body of work, highlighting his enduring influence on literature, art, and thought worldwide. Part of the Unesco Collection of Representative Works - Indian Series. This book has been accepted in the Indian Translation Series of the UNESCO Collection of Represented Works, jointly sponsored by the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O), and the Government of India.
